Ticket re: fire-drill roll call at the Ardenfell site, scheduled Thursday 10:15. Requesting that the assembly-point cabinet be stocked with fresh roll-call sheets and two working tablets beforehand. Please also confirm the cabinet lock has been reset since last quarter's drill. For reference, the current keypad entry is:

turnstile pass: bdg-LHXLMH-99783802

# Approvals: Tax-Rate Lookup Cache

The Ledgerline tax-rate cache holds jurisdiction rates for 24 hours and is refreshed nightly from the rates service. Manual cache flushes are approval-gated because a flush during business hours triggers a thundering-herd refresh. On-call may flush a single jurisdiction without approval; full flushes require sign-off. TTL changes, schema changes, and fallback-rate edits always require approval, no exceptions during quarter close. All such requests go to the approver named below.

named custodian: Brivan Eliath Quenox Frador

## Tuning the watchdog

The Pellgrove kiosk watchdog restarts the shell process when heartbeats stop. All thresholds are configurable but conservative by default: the restart window is wide enough to tolerate slow storage, and consecutive failures escalate to a full device reboot. From a security standpoint, note that the watchdog runs unprivileged and cannot modify the image; it only signals the supervisor. The shipped constants are listed below.

constants for fajop-tahaf:
RATE_LIMITS = {
    "holael": 2,
    "oliael": 10,
    "druael": 10,
    "wenwyn": 10,
}

☐ Off-site run — Sealed-bid tender (Kestrel Bridge project)

Heads up, dispatch: the sealed tender envelope for the Kestrel Bridge job has to reach the Morrowgate council office before the noon deadline — no exceptions, late bids get binned unopened. Envelope stays sealed, flat, and out of sight in the cab. Get a stamped receipt on delivery and bring it straight back. The confidential hand-over instruction for the courier follows below.

dispatch memo: the quenax olidor courier leaves the lamvan aldath keliel ledger at gate 2085 under passcode 005795